At Dr Sep Aesthetics, polynucleotide (PN) therapy is a breakthrough in non-surgical hair restoration.
Polynucleotides are purified DNA fragments that work at a cellular level to repair scalp tissue, improve microcirculation, and create an optimal environment for hair follicle regeneration.
By reducing inflammation and boosting cell turnover, PN therapy encourages dormant follicles to re-enter the growth phase — delivering a healthier, denser head of hair.

Polynucleotide Hair Restoration at a Glance
Ideal Outcome: Stronger hair, reduced shedding, improved scalp health
Visible Results: 6–12 weeks, with progressive improvement
Effects Last: 12+ months with maintenance
Risk: Low
Treatment Time: 30–45 minutes
Discomfort: Mild (numbing cream optional)
Downtime: None
Practitioner: Aesthetic Doctor
Maintenance: Every 6–12 months after initial course

Step-by-Step Guide to Polynucleotide Hair Restoration
1. Consultation & Assessment
We assess your hair density, scalp health, and overall hair loss pattern to ensure PN therapy is the right choice for you.
2. Preparation
The scalp is cleansed and numbed with topical anaesthetic for comfort.
3. Application
The PN solution is microinjected into targeted areas of thinning, stimulating repair and regeneration from within.
4. Recovery & Aftercare
Minimal downtime — you can resume normal activities straight away. Aftercare guidance will be given to optimise results.
